Go to the FAA website and look up the conversation requirements. You can do the FAA validation program and a foreign pilot instrument written. The FAA will then issue you a FAA Private Pilot certificate with an instrument rating. Then you can do an upgrade/recurrent course in the 139. Since it is a Level D sim you should be able to do the type in the sim. You will have to make arrangements far enough in advance so you can be scheduled properly. If the facility doesn't have a qualified examiner on staff they will have to bring in an inspector.
